HC Deb 12 May 1862 vol 166 c1558
MR. W. EWART

said, he wished to ask the Secretary of State for War, If a Soldiers' Institute will be formed at Portsmouth, in conformity with the Report of Captain Pilkington Jackson?

SIR GEORGE LEWIS

said, that the Government had taken a Vote for the creation of Soldiers' Institutes without stating at what particular places they were to be established. He should be prepared to appropriate a portion of the sum towards providing an Institute at Portsmouth, but its precise site had not yet been determined on.
